Successfully reported this slideshow.
We use your LinkedIn profile and activity data to personalize ads and to show you more relevant ads. You can change your ad preferences anytime.

エクセルファイルをアップロードしてHTMLを自動生成

216 views

Published on

Q and AタイプのWebページ制作の生産性をアップする: ExcelファイルからQ-A(QuestionーAnswer)ページを自動生成

製品ナビゲータページの制作システム

Published in: Technology
  • Be the first to comment

  • Be the first to like this

エクセルファイルをアップロードしてHTMLを自動生成

  1. 1. © 2016 Antenna House, Inc. © 2017 Antenna House, Inc. 2017年12月8日 アンテナハウス株式会社 S1システム営業 Webページ制作の 生産性をアップ ExcelファイルからQ-A(Questio-Answer) ページを自動生成するサービスのご提案
  2. 2. © 2017 Antenna House, Inc. Webページ制作の生産性アップ
  3. 3. © 2017 Antenna House, Inc. Q-Aページは手作業で編集。 Q-Aページはリンクが多く、Q-A項目を追加する 毎に、Webページを手作業で更新するのは面倒。 QAページ(HTML)の製作 Excelファイルに質問と回答の内容を整理・編集 Excelファイルをアップすると自動的にWebページ に変換する仕組を作成 Webページ制作の生産性アップ
  4. 4. © 2017 Antenna House, Inc. 3 QAページ(HTML)の自動生成 •入力はExcelファイル。 データベースの代わりに使い慣れたExcelを使用。 システム構築・管理は不要。 •出力はhtmlファイル。 生成されたhtmlファイルをWebサイトに配置すれ ば完成。 Webページ制作の生産性アップ
  5. 5. © 2017 Antenna House, Inc. Excelのフォーマット •1行で1レコード •列の情報は5つ 大分類、小分類、対象製品、質問、回答 Webページ制作の生産性アップ
  6. 6. © 2017 Antenna House, Inc. 生成されるHTML •ヘッダ、フッダ、サイドバー 外部ファイルとして与える 質問と回答部分を含んだHTMLとして出力 •メインHTML 大分類、小分類で段落を生成 大分類毎にサブHTMLを生成 •サブHTML 小分類で段落を生成 質問から回答へのリンクを設定 Webページ制作の生産性アップ
  7. 7. © 2017 Antenna House, Inc. 「製品ナビゲータ」ページ システム・ソリューション製品の「製品ナビゲータ」 ページを11月末に公開。 http://www.antenna.co.jp/system/faq/index.html 大分類が10個あるので、メインHTMLが1、 サブHTMLが10ファイル。 「1. 自動組版」 が大分類。 「1.1 CSVをレイアウトしてPDFを出力」 が小分類 小分類をクリックすると、サブHTMLにジャンプ 小分類に属する質問が2件あり、質問をクリックすると、 回答へジャンプ。 Webページ制作の生産性アップ
  8. 8. © 2017 Antenna House, Inc. Xlsx2Html.Jar •Xlsx2Html.jar Excel(.xlsx)ファイルを読み込み、 htmlファイルを生成する Javaアプリケーション Java が動作する環境であれば サーバ上でも、クライアント上でも実行可能。 Webページ制作の生産性アップ
  9. 9. © 2017 Antenna House, Inc. •カスタマイズ Xlsx2Html.jar は汎用ではありませんが、 データ(xlsx)やページ(html)に合わせて 比較的簡単にカスタマイズ可能。 Xlsx2Html.Jar Webページ制作の生産性アップ 関心をお持ちのお客様には、カスタマイズして 専用のものを構築致します。 お問い合わせ先:cas-info@antenna.co.jp

×